Window Replacement Cost uk - What You Need to Know

Replace your windows with double glazing to increase your home's security and cut down on your energy bills. In addition to this it can also increase the value of your home.

It is important to choose an certified FENSA or CERTASS installer to ensure that your windows comply with UK Building Regulations. This will also safeguard you from scams and fraud.

What type of windows do you want?

The kind of window you decide to replace your existing windows could have a significant impact on the overall cost. uPVC is the most common window type in the UK, and it can be quite affordable. It is also extremely robust and secure. There are also many other types of windows that you can install in your home. Some are more costly than others, but they all offer a range of advantages.

The kind of window you choose can have a significant impact on the energy efficiency of your home, regardless of whether you're replacing one pane or upgrading your entire home. It is crucial to choose the perfect window for your budget and needs therefore, take the time to shop around and compare estimates. When you are comparing quotes, take a look at the cost of the window itself as well as the installation. Include any scaffolding costs, if needed.

You should also consider the age of your home when choosing the style. Older homes require different types of window, while newer ones may need something modern. Take into consideration how your windows will be able to fit into the architectural style of your house. If you own a listed building or live in a conservation area Be sure to check with your local council before making changes to any of your windows.

Energy-efficient windows that comply with standards for thermal efficiency set by the government are the best to reduce utility bills. These windows can be identified by their BFRC ratings and Energy Saving Trust Logo. Also look for Window Replacement Cost uk windows that have a low carbon foot print and are made of recycled materials. They will help cut down on the cost of heating and also improve the appearance of your home.

The size of the window

The size and quantity of windows at your house will directly impact the cost of double-glazed windows. In general replacing larger windows can cost more than replacing smaller ones. This is because larger windows require more materials and can be more difficult to install. Whatever the size windows, all replacement windows must be in compliance with the UK's energy efficiency standards and be uPVC. This kind of window provides the highest return on investment and is the most popular one in the UK.

The material you select for your frame will have a major impact on the total cost of your new windows. uPVC is the most affordable option, but it can fade, warp or buckle with time. Composite windows are more expensive, but they offer better heat retention. They also require less maintenance. They're a better investment over the long term than uPVC and are fully recyclable, whereas uPVC is not.

Regardless of the style or material you select It is always recommended to obtain multiple estimates and shop around for the most affordable prices. Find a reliable fitter with references and proof of professional indemnity insurance. This will protect you from rogue traders and protect you in the event of a problem with your new windows.

Before you contact any companies, work out how many windows you'll need to replace window pane and their approximate dimensions. You must be as accurate and precise as possible in order to create an accurate budget. Make sure you have planning permission before starting the work. This is particularly crucial if you are located in a conservation area or an listed building. In this instance you'll need to ask your local council to obtain permission prior to making any modifications.

The kind of glass

The type of glass you choose will determine the cost for the installation, regardless of whether you are using new uPVC or an efficient timber frame. For instance double glazing window replacement-glazed windows are more than single-glazed windows. The cost of Low-E or argon-gas filled glass will also rise. Energy-efficient glass is essential for homeowners since it helps keep the house warm and helps to lower fuel costs.

When it comes down to window frames, there are many alternatives available, including aluminium as well as timber. However, timber is more expensive than uPVC and could require more maintenance, including painting. Furthermore, if you reside in an listed building or conservation area, you could be limited in the kind of window frame you can install.

uPVC is the most popular material used for window frames. It is sturdy and cost-effective. It is also easy to clean and requires little maintenance, other than cleaning the windows with water and detergent and a little Vaseline on the hinges. This stays once or twice a year. The ideal window frame could determine the quality of the windows you put in So take your time to consider the advantages and disadvantages.

The cost of replacing your windows can be a significant investment, but it's one that will increase the value, security, and beauty of your home. Comparing quotes, products and warranties from different window manufacturers will ensure you get the most affordable price. If you are installing new uPVC Windows, it's essential to employ a certified window installer who can guarantee that your installation is compliant with UK Building Regulations. This will protect your house and ensure that the window is installed correctly.

The style of windows

You can choose from a wide range of styles when replacing your windows. Certain windows are more expensive than others, but the most appropriate choice can help you save money in the long run. The latest windows that are energy efficient can, for instance, lower your heating bills by keeping the warm air in and cold out. They can also increase the value of your home, which is why it's worth spending a bit more to find the most efficient option for your home.

uPVC is a very popular choice. They are strong they require minimal maintenance and have excellent insulation properties. They are available in many different styles and colors, so you can choose the one that is perfect for your home. Be aware that uPVC will begin to yellow with time. It is important to select a provider that makes use of uPVC of top quality.

Composite windows and timber frames are alternatives to replace windows. Wooden frames look stunning in any kind of home and are often more aesthetically pleasing than uPVC. They are more expensive and require more maintenance than uPVC. Composite windows are made of plastic and wood. They are generally less expensive than wooden frames, but they can still be quite costly.

Consider getting estimates from local companies prior to replacing your windows. You'll be able to get an idea of the price range, and they may offer a discount for ordering multiple windows. Remember to account for any additional expenses, like scaffolding if you're replacing windows on the upper floor of your home.

The type of installer

The choice you make about an organization will have a significant impact on the cost of your window replacement in the UK. It is recommended to get multiple quotes from different companies before making a choice. You will save money and get the best price on new windows. The most reliable installers offer high-quality products and services at affordable costs. It is also important to check whether they are registered with FENSA and CERTASS this is a good indication that they are in compliance with UK Building Regulations.

The kind of frame you choose will also impact the price of your project. For instance, uPVC is the most popular and affordable option, while aluminium and timber are more expensive. The size of your home will also influence the cost. The price of windows with larger sizes will be higher than those with smaller windows because they require more labor and materials. Also, you'll require scaffolding costs if your windows are that are higher than the ground.

You will save money if you choose windows that are energy efficient. They will increase insulation and keep the heat from leaving your home, which will lower your heating costs. They will last longer and be easier to maintain than single-glazed windows.

The replacement of your windows is an excellent way to increase the value of your home, and can also make it more attractive to prospective buyers.
